DHAKA: Planning Minister AHM Mustafa Kamal on Tuesday said it would take over 50 years to eliminate corruption from the country.

“There is no corruption free country in the world. The government wants to eradicate corruption in phases,” he said.

The planning minister came up with the observation while talking to journalists after a meeting of the Executive Committee of the National Economic Council (ECNEC).

The lawmaker also said, “We will show zero tolerance regarding the corrupted people.”

He urged journalists to write against the opportunists who use to introduce them as ‘Chhatra League’ and involved in corruption.

Mustafa Kamal also mentioned that once he was also an activist of Chhatra League but no one could say he was involved in any kind of corruptions.

Earlier, the ECNEC approved the 'Palli Janapad' project involving Tk 424.34 crore where 272 families will be able to live.

State minister for the planning MA Mannan, secretaries Bhuiyan Safiqul Islam and Suraiya Begum were among others present at the meeting.
